   167 void usage()
       
   168 {
       
   169     
       
   170 	cout << "USAGE: HtiGateway.exe [SWITCHES in form -switch=value]\n\n";
       
   171     cout << "\tSWITCHES:\n";
       
   172     cout << "\t-port         TCP/IP port\n";
       
   173     cout << "\t-bufsize      TCP/IP receive buffer size in bytes\n";
       
   174     cout << "\t-commchannel  Communication Channel Plugin (CCP) name e.g. SERIAL\n";
       
   175     cout << "\t-stayalive    Whether HtiGateway remains when client disconnects\n";
       
   176     cout << "\t              or not\n";
       
   177     cout << "\t-cclateinit   Whether CCP is initialized when client connects or not\n";
       
   178     cout << "\t-swt          Maximum shutdown wait time in milliseconds. 0 means\n";
       
   179     cout << "\t              no waiting.\n";
       
   180     cout << "\t-v            Verbose mode\n";
       
   181     cout << "\t-t            Timestamped output\n\n";
       
   182     cout << "\tBy default these values are defined in HtiGateway.ini file.\n";
       
   183     cout << "\tIf any switches are used those override values from ini file\n\n";
       
   184     cout << "\tSTAYALIVE:\n";
       
   185     cout << "\tfalse      HtiGateway shutdown after client closes connection\n";
       
   186     cout << "\ttrue       HtiGateway remains waiting new connections (*)\n\n";
       
   187     cout << "\tCCLATEINIT:\n";
       
   188     cout << "\tfalse      HtiGateway initializes CCP when started (*)\n";
       
   189     cout << "\ttrue       HtiGateway initializes CCP only when client connects to\n\n";
       
   190     cout << "\tVERBOSE:\n";
       
   191     cout << "\toff        Silent mode\n";
       
   192     cout << "\tresult     Prints only result (no info/errors)\n";
       
   193     cout << "\terror      Prints result and errors (*)\n";
       
   194     cout << "\tinfo       Prints normal output\n";
       
   195     cout << "\tdebug      Prints all\n\n";
       
   196     cout << "\tTIMESTAMPED:\n";
       
   197     cout << "\tfalse      No timestamp (*)\n";
       
   198     cout << "\ttrue       Adds timestamp to output\n\n";
       
   199     cout << "\t(*) means default value\n\n";
       
   200     cout << "\tAll communication channel plugin parameters can also be passed from\n";
       
   201     cout << "\tcommand line just by adding \"-\" to the parameter name. For example:\n";
       
   202 	cout << "\t\"-COMPORT=COM3\" or -REMOTE_PORT=3000\n";
       
   203     cout << endl;
       
   204 }
